Hi all, since fitting my OE Bluetooth telephone, it bothered me that I could never get my phone (Galaxy s6) to play any audio via Bluetooth. The phone part works great. So today I got vcds connected up and found out how to make it work. Go into 77 telephone....07 coding...long coding helper...byte 6 multimedia function (Bluetooth audio) inactive. Simply uncheck the box...close the box then "do it!"....
It works!!! Yeay!...and the track listing comes up on the radio screen and on the dash....can't believe it's that simple!...
Works every time now, even with you tube!...you won't be able to watch videos though..

Yep, it's always a coding issue when people upgrade RNS firmwares and stuff stops working. If people would just think before throwing firmwares at them then they'd have far less issues. Just copying the units coding first and then reapplying it afterwards would sort any possible issues.

However, your problem was fixed by a phone module coding change. That shouldn't have been affected in this case with an RNS firmware update.
